After you live somewhere for thirty years, you forget what you have. Here is a collection of photos of the arts and crafts show and the surrounding views. This weekend (6/26-6/28) we are at Kings Beach (Lake Tahoe), California. We live in Truckee, which is only 10 miles away. I worked for 30 years for the telephone company and 23 of those years at Lake Tahoe and Truckee. It was not unusual to be 20 feet up a pole working and looking at these same views. I have been so blessed to live here and experience all of this ... even the winters. You see, I did have an outside job.
